Graduate Program

CSUS Economics offers an MA in Economics. For information regarding the structure of the program, contact the Graduate Program Coordinator, Kristin VanGaasbeck.

The Master of Arts program in Economics is designed to assist students to develop the analytical skills and reflective capacities required to think clearly and coherently about economic matters and to apply their skill and knowledge effectively to problem areas. The program seeks to prepare students for careers where economics is applicable. The department offers coursework and supervised study in economic theory, quantitative analysis, and a number of other fields of interest.

IIn line with the applied emphasis of the Graduate Program, the department maintains a relationship with both the California State government and many private organizations in the Sacramento area. Graduates of the master's degree program have gone on to jobs in government at all levels as well as to careers in labor unions, banks, manufacturing corporations, and other forms of private organizations.
